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:
- Develops a transformational coaching statement which is clearly communicated to staff, team members and parents.
- Supports GHS athletics vision and values statement (Refer to the Athletic Handbook).
- Works with other coaches to support multi-sport athletes.
- Works with the Athletic Director for all matters relating to the organization, administration and philosophy of the sport under his/her direction.
- Serves in a leadership capacity to the community program.
- Oversees the high school program in his/her sport and supports the middle school and elementary programs.
- Coaches individual participants in the skills necessary for excellent achievement in the sport involved.
- Maintains competency in IHSAA rules, event procedures, coaching techniques and general information about all aspects of the sport.
- Is a member of the state coaching association that honors Academic All-state student athletes
- Recommends teams that may be scheduled to the Athletic Director.
QUALIFICATIONS:
- Player experience.
- Middle School or High School coaching experience preferred.
- Experience in teaching, coaching, and sports medicine preferred.
- Strong communication, motivational and organization skills.
- Team building abilities and working in a collaborative environment are essential for a Head Coach.
- Demonstrate success in area of application.
